      Matsumoto Kôshirô VII (松本幸四郎) as 
      Musashibô Benkei (武蔵坊弁慶)
      
      Play: Kanjinchô (勧進帳)
      Performance Place: ?
      Performance Date:
      Print Date: ?
      Medium: Woodblock printed fan
       
      Note: Kôshirô VII first performed this role in Tokyo at the
      Teikoku Gekijô 
      in April 1914.  His final appearance in Tokyo in this role
      was at the Tokyo 
      Gekijô in June 1946.

      [Kumadori (隈取)]
      
      Print Date: ?
      Personal Collection 
       
      Note: This print shows the kumadori makeup for, inter 
      alia, Asahina (朝比奈の隈),  Tsuchigumo (土蜘),
       Kugeaku Tokihei (公家悪時平),  Kitsune Tadanobu 
      (狐忠信),  Sukeroku (助六),  Shakkyô (石橋),  Umeômaru 
      (梅王丸), Matsuômaru (松王丸), Sakuramaru (桜丸), and
      Gedatsu (解脱).
